The environmental impact of chemicals used in large-scale industrial processes is a growing concern. Traditional water treatment chemicals, particularly those containing phosphorus, can contribute to eutrophication in water bodies. HPMA addresses this by providing excellent performance without the environmental drawbacks associated with phosphorus compounds. This makes it a sustainable choice for industries aiming to minimize their ecological footprint.
HPMA's efficacy stems from its molecular structure, which allows it to interfere with crystal growth and prevent scale formation. It works by distorting the crystal lattice of common scale-forming minerals like calcium carbonate and calcium sulfate. This distortion results in loose, easily dispersed particles rather than hard, adherent scale deposits. This mechanism not only prevents new scale from forming but can also aid in the removal of existing scale, a phenomenon often referred to as scale stripping. For industries that depend on the smooth flow of water and efficient heat transfer, such as those utilizing circulating cooling water systems or low-pressure boilers, these properties are invaluable.
The dispersion properties of HPMA are equally important. It helps to keep suspended particles finely divided within the water, preventing them from agglomerating and settling out. This is particularly useful in applications where solids need to remain suspended, such as in certain industrial processes or when used as an additive in formulations. The ability of HPMA to act as a dispersant enhances the overall stability and performance of various industrial mixtures.
While HPMA is primarily recognized for its scale inhibition, its role in corrosion control is also significant. When formulated with synergistic agents like zinc salts, HPMA contributes to the formation of protective films on metal surfaces, thereby reducing the rate of corrosion. This dual functionality makes HPMA a cost-effective solution for managing the complex challenges of water system maintenance. The versatility of HPMA is further demonstrated by its application in diverse sectors. Beyond industrial water treatment, it finds use in the oil and gas industry to manage scale in production fluids and in cement admixtures to enhance material properties. Its heat stability and effectiveness in alkaline conditions make it suitable for a wide array of industrial environments.
